I am a unique and highly productive "all-season" mango variety from Thailand, often nicknamed "ATM" because I am like an "Any Time Mango" that provides fruit throughout the year. I produce medium-sized, attractive fruits with a smooth skin and a rich, golden-yellow flesh that is famously sweet, aromatic, and completely free of fiber.
I am a perennial bearing mango tree known for my incredible ability to flower and fruit in multiple flushes, ensuring a harvest even during the traditional off-season.
I am a specialized cultivar from Thailand, bred specifically for high-frequency fruiting and commercial viability in tropical climates.
I require a consistent watering schedule to support my frequent fruiting cycles, but I must have well-draining soil to prevent my roots from suffocating.
I crave full, direct sunlight for at least 6 to 8 hours a day to power my continuous growth and to sweeten my fruit.
I am most comfortable in warm, tropical environments between 24°C and 36°C and should be protected from extreme cold or frost.
I have a relatively manageable growth habit, making me suitable for medium-sized gardens or large drums if pruned regularly.
Because I work hard to produce fruit all year, I need regular feeding with organic compost and a balanced fertilizer every few months.
My scientific name is Mangifera indica 'Thai ATM' and I belong to the Anacardiaceae family.
My fruit flesh is a safe treat for pets, but please keep them away from my leaves, bark, and sap which can be irritating.
My lush, evergreen canopy provides year-round air filtration, absorbing carbon dioxide and releasing fresh oxygen into your surroundings.
I am a gardener's favorite because I offer a "ready-to-pick" supply of Vitamin C and antioxidants nearly every month of the year.
I can be prone to mango hoppers during my frequent flowering stages, so keep an eye out for pests to ensure a healthy harvest.
I am a long-lived and sturdy tree that can remain a productive part of your orchard for 30 to 40 years with proper care.
